What does the Bible say about swearing and bad language?
Scripture is less interested in a list of forbidden words than in whether your speech builds people up or tears them down.
What Scripture says
Ephesians 4:29
“Let no corrupt speech proceed out of your mouth, but only what is good for building others up as the need may be, that it may give grace to those who hear.”
Colossians 3:8
“but now you must put them all away: anger, wrath, malice, slander, and shameful speaking out of your mouth.”
James 3:9-10
“With it we bless our God and Father, and with it we curse men who are made in the image of God. Out of the same mouth comes blessing and cursing. My brothers, these things ought not to be so.”
Matthew 12:36
“I tell you that every idle word that men speak, they will give account of it in the day of judgment.”
